Actress Jane Seymour and her fourth husband, producer-director James Keach, have separated and plan to end their 20-year marriage.

Jane, 62, reportedly gave him the boot from their Malibu mansion after suspecting that he was engaging in an extra-marital affair.

Her rep stated, “Jane Seymour and James Keach confirm that they are separated and have been for several months. At this time they are negotiating the terms of their divorce.”

“They will continue their relationship as devoted parents to their children, as business associates and partners and in their joint dedication to preserving and furthering the charitable endeavors that they’ve worked on throughout their marriage.”

Seymour and Keach have two sons, twins John and Kristopher, 17. The actress also has two children with her third husband David Flynn, daughter Katherine, 31, and son Sean, 27.

The marriage to Flynn ended in 1992 after she confronted him about cheating and he admitted to 14 affairs.

Jane, who gained fame in the 90’s as ‘Dr. Quinn, Medicine Woman,’ recently told friends she wishes James the best. She even threw a celebratory Easter party and declared that it was a very symbolic holiday this year because it’s a new beginning for her as well – she called it her own personal resurrection.
